Time Management - Invoice - Freelancer
Download and customize a free Time Management Invoice Freelancer Excel template. Perfect for business, legal, and personal use. Editable and ready to boost your productivity.
| Date | Task Description | Estimated Time (hrs) | Actual Time (hrs) | Time Management Status | Notes |
|---|---|---|---|---|---|
| 2024-04-01 | Client Meeting – Project Kickoff | 1.5 | 1.75 | On Track | Agreed on timelines and deliverables. |
| 2024-04-03 | Design Wireframes | 4.0 | 3.5 | On Track | Client approved initial concept. |
| 2024-04-05 | Develop Backend API | 6.0 | 7.25 | Over Time | Unforeseen third-party integration delay. |
| 2024-04-08 | Frontend UI Implementation | 5.0 | 4.75 | On Track | All components completed with minor tweaks. |
| 2024-04-10 | Testing and Bug Fixes | 3.5 | 3.0 | Under Time | No critical bugs found; testing completed early. |
Freelancer Time Management Invoice Excel Template – Detailed Description
This comprehensive Excel template is specifically designed for freelancersinvoices. By combining the core principles of time tracking with invoice creation, this template allows freelancers to seamlessly log hours worked on client projects, categorize tasks by type or client, and automatically generate invoices based on that data. This integration ensures that every hour logged directly contributes to revenue tracking—making financial reporting not only accurate but also actionable.
The template is styled in a clean, modern Freelancer format—optimized for simplicity, readability, and quick data entry. It avoids complex configurations while still offering powerful features such as automated calculations, conditional formatting for task priority alerts, and visual dashboards that help freelancers monitor workload and cash flow.
SHEET NAMES
The template consists of the following sheets:
- Time Log: Primary sheet where all time entries are recorded.
- Invoice Generator: A dynamic sheet that auto-generates invoices from logged hours and client details.
- Client Dashboard: Visual summary of clients, total hours, revenue, and overdue payments.
- Reports & Analytics: Monthly summaries including time allocation by project or client type.
- Settings: Configuration for rates per hour, tax rules, currency settings, and default billing cycles.
TABLE STRUCTURES & COLUMNS
Each sheet contains structured tables with clearly defined columns and data types:
Time Log Sheet
- Date: Date/time of time entry (Data Type: Date/Time)
- Project Name: Name of the client project (Text, up to 50 characters)
- Client Name: Client's full name or company (Text)
- Task Description: Brief task summary (Text, max 100 chars)
- Start Time: Start of work session (Time, HH:MM format)
- End Time: End of work session (Time, HH:MM format)
- Duration (hours): Auto-calculated duration in hours and minutes (Decimal or time value)
- Rate per Hour ($): Freelancer's hourly rate (Currency, e.g., 30.00)
- Subtotal ($): Duration × Rate (Auto-calculated as currency)
- Status: "Logged", "Pending", or "Invoiced" (Text dropdown)
Invoice Generator Sheet
- Client Name: Selected from a dynamic list (Text)
- Project Title: Pre-populated from Time Log or user input (Text) <8>Total Hours Worked: Sum of all logged hours for the client/project (Auto-sum)
- Rate per Hour ($): Pulls from Settings sheet (Currency, locked value)
- Invoice Amount ($): Total Hours × Rate (Auto-calculated as currency)
- Due Date: Set by user or auto-generated (Date/Time)
- Status: "Draft", "Sent", "Paid", "Overdue" (Text, dropdown)
- Invoice Number: Auto-generated unique ID with date and sequential number (e.g., INV-20240515-03)
- Notes: Optional remarks (Text, optional field)
FORMULAS REQUIRED
The template leverages a range of Excel functions to ensure accuracy and automation:
=TIMEVALUE("End Time") - TIMEVALUE("Start Time")– Calculates duration in hours.=IF(EndTime="", "", Duration)– Prevents errors if end time is missing.=SUMIFS(Subtotal, Client, "Client A", Status, "Invoiced")– Sums invoiceable amounts per client.=CONCATENATE("INV-", YEAR(TODAY()), "-", RIGHT(100*MONTH(TODAY()), 2), "-", ROW(A1))– Generates unique invoice numbers.=IF(Status="Overdue", "⚠️ Overdue", "")– Flags overdue invoices in red.=ROUND(Worked Hours * Hourly Rate, 2)– Ensures two decimal places for currency precision.
CONDITIONAL FORMATTING
The template uses conditional formatting to improve visual clarity:
- Highlight overdue invoices in red: Applies when Due Date is less than today and Status = "Sent".
- Color-code task duration by length: Green for ≤2 hours, Yellow for 2–4 hours, Red for >4 hours.
- Highlight high-value projects: Projects with invoice amount > $500 use a light blue background.
- Flag pending entries in gray: When Status = "Pending" in the Time Log sheet.
USER INSTRUCTIONS
To use this template effectively:
- Open the Excel file and navigate to the Time Log sheet. Enter each work session using standard formatting.
- In the Invoice Generator, select a client or project from dropdowns to generate a new invoice.
- The template will auto-calculate total hours, subtotal, and invoice number based on logged data.
- Set due dates and status (Draft/Sent/Paid) to manage payment tracking.
- Use the Client Dashboard to visualize workload distribution across clients monthly.
- To generate reports, go to the Reports & Analytics sheet and use filters for client, project type, or date range.
- Add new tasks or adjust hourly rates via the Settings sheet—changes propagate automatically across all sheets.
EXAMPLE ROWS (Time Log Sheet)
Date | Project Name | Client Name | Task Description | Start Time | End Time | Duration (hrs) | Rate ($) | Subtotal ($) 2024-05-10 | Website Redesign | TechFlow Inc. "UI/UX mockups" 9:00 AM 11:30 AM 2.5 45.00 112.50 2024-05-12 | Content Strategy | GreenLeaf Media "Social media plan" 14:30 PM 16:45 PM 2.25 35.00 81.75
RECOMMENDED CHARTS & DASHBOARDS
To enhance decision-making, the template includes these visual tools:
- Bar Chart – Monthly Time Allocation by Client: Shows how time is distributed across clients.
- Stacked Column Chart – Revenue vs. Invoiced Hours: Compares total income with effort per project.
- Pie Chart – Task Type Distribution: Visualizes work split between design, writing, development, etc.
- Line Graph – Daily Workload Trend (Last 30 Days): Helps identify peak productivity periods.
- Dashboard Summary Panel: A compact view showing total time logged, pending invoices, and total revenue in the current month.
In conclusion, this Time Management and Invoice-focused template tailored for the modern Freelancer delivers unmatched efficiency. It turns fragmented work hours into structured financial records, enabling freelancers to bill accurately, track performance, and grow sustainably—all within a single intuitive Excel file.
⬇️ Download as Excel✏️ Edit online as ExcelCreate your own Excel template with our GoGPT AI prompt:
GoGPT